On 01/07/2016 08:54 PM, jacob Kruger wrote:
> I would definitely like to try out something like this - I am primarily 
> a web developer, and, partly since am 100% blind, any form of GUI design 
> is at times an issue for me, whereas I have been working with HTML 
> markup layouts for almost 20 years now, but, which versions of python 
> should this work with, and, what does it actually then use to 
> generate/handle GUI interface? Ask since, some of the GUI frameworks are 
> not too accessible themselves.

This project is simply a web browser (qtwebkit) embedded in a bare
window that automatically loads a python-based web application you write
separately.  That's all it is.  It's not a GUI toolkit or even a
web-based GUI toolkit.  It's primary purpose is to allow you to wrap up
a Python-based web app (using Flask, but I have no doubt it could handle
Django) in a little self-contained package so you can run it as if it
were a standalone app. Kind of like how Google Chrome let's you take a
url and make a virtual app out of it.
